Analysis
In 2024, average tariff applied by developed countries, preferential status in Cuba stood at 13.0%.
The figure is down 1.8% on the previous year and down 49.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, average tariff applied by developed countries, preferential status in Cuba peaked at 25.8% in 2016 and was at its lowest, 11.5%, in 2013.
That places Cuba 19th out of 219 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the top 10%.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 17 years of available data.
